Default filepath/permissions issue?

I'm trying to view some easter eggs in a game I own, which requires me to
modify the .ini file for it. I did this in XP with no trouble, but Vista
keeps telling me it can't create the filepath to save the modified file or
that I don't have permission to modify this file. I've already adjusted the
properties and "allowed" everything. Any other ideas?

Hi Tom,
"c:\program files" is a special folder in Vista, and direct manipulation of
the files is pretty much impossible. What you need to do is save the
modified .ini file to your desktop, then you can drag it to the right
location and overwrite the original. Don't ask me why, but it should work.

Hope that helps!
